Improving Access to Institutional Mental Health Care Act
Impact
If enacted, HB 8767 will modify existing Medicaid regulations to allow for support of items and services for individuals in mental health institutions, thus directly impacting the state's approach to mental health care funding. The proposed amendments are set to take effect on October 1, 2024, implying a prepared timeline for state agencies to adjust regulations and providers to adapt to the new inclusion criteria. The bill seeks to address gaps in mental health services, promoting a more inclusive healthcare system for individuals with mental health needs.
Summary
House Bill 8767, titled the 'Improving Access to Institutional Mental Health Care Act', aims to amend title XIX of the Social Security Act by removing the exclusion of items and services provided to patients in institutions for mental diseases from Medicaid assistance. This bill is significant in its intention to enhance access to mental health care for those who require institutional treatment, a population that has faced barriers in receiving comprehensive medical assistance under the current guidelines.
Contention
Debate surrounding HB 8767 may arise from concerns regarding the potential financial implications for state budgets and Medicaid expenditures as states would need to allocate additional resources to support the expanded coverage. Opponents might argue about the increased strain on the Medicaid system, while supporters will highlight the urgent need for mental health access, especially in light of rising mental health issues across the country. The conversation will likely involve discussions on balancing fiscal responsibility with the necessity of providing adequate mental health care.
